| description | In present study the effect of feeding frequency on some health aspects (biologicalparameters) of fingerling of common carp were investigated. Three groups of common carp(average weight4.31±0.1 g) designed with three feeding frequencies one meal a day (D1),two meals a day (D2) and three meals a day (D3) with three replicates of each treatment. Fishin experimental treatments were fed by 4% of body weight. No significant differencesobserved in Hepatosomatic Index, Gill Index and muscle ratio (Weight without Viscera andWeight without Viscera & Head) in all feeding frequencies, feeding one and two time perday were significantly higher than three times/ day in each of Kidney index and SpleenIndex. Intestine weight index was significantly higher in T2 and T3, Intestine Length Indexwas higher significantly in T3. |
